- 1、本文档共64页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《计算机网络和 与因特网》课件第二章客户-服务器交互.ppt
TCP multiplexing and demultiplexing UDP multiplexing and demultiplexing A sufficiently powerful computer system can run multiple clients and servers at the same time. The computer needs only a single physical connection to the internet. 3.11 Identifying A Particular Service Transport protocol assign each service a unique identifier. Both clients and servers specify the service identifier. Protocol software uses the identifier to direct each incoming request to the correct server. 3.14 transport protocols and unambiguous communication Transport protocols assign an identifier to each client as well as to each service. Protocol software on the server’s machine uses the combination of client and server identifiers to choose the correct copy of a concurrent server. TCP程序就可以通过TCP报头中由源主机指出的端口地址,了解到发送主机希望目标主机的什么应用层程序接收这个数据报。 UDP程序就可以通过UDP报头中由源主机指出的端口地址,了解到发送主机希望目标主机的什么应用层程序接收这个数据报。 为了在通信时不致发生混乱,就必须把端口号和主机的IP地址结合在一起使用。 一个TCP连接由它的两个端点来标识,而每个端点又是由IP地址和端口号决定的。 将TCP连接的端点称为Socket(插口)。 对于无连接的UDP,虽然在相互通信的两个进程之间没有一条虚连接, 但发送端UDP一定有一个发送端口而在接收端UDP也一定有一个接收端口。 UDP也必须使用Socket(插口) ,才能区分多个主机中同时通信的多个进程。 端口分两类:熟知端口(0-1023)和一般端口(1024-65535). TCP/IP规定端口号的编排方法: 低于255的编号:用于FTP、HTTP这样的公共应用层协议。 255到1023的编号:提供给操作系统开发公司,为市场化的应用层协议编号。 大于1023的编号:普通应用程序。 除了社会公认度很高的应用层协议,才能使用1023以下的端口地址编号。 一般的应用程序通讯,需要在1023以上进行编号。例如,知名的游戏软件CS的端口地址设定为26350。 端口地址的编码范围从0到65535。从1024到49151的地址范围需要注册使用,49152到65535的地址范围可以自由使用。 IANA ranges Computer Networks and Internets 《计算机网络与因特网》课件 林坤辉 PART IV Network Applications Chapter 3 Client-Server Interaction 客户-服务器交互 3.1 Introduction Heterogeneous networks can be interconnected. Protocol software used to achieve reliable transport across the resulting internet. The combination of networking hardware and protocol software results in a general-purpose communication infrastructure. It allows application programs on an arbitrary pair of computers to communicate. Every application program must inc
您可能关注的文档
- 《航海雷达和 与ARPA》Ch2船用雷达设备.ppt
- 《艾滋病防治条例》和 与领导干部的责任ppt .ppt
- 《花卉生产技术知识》课件第九章宿根花卉.ppt
- 《花卉生产技术知识》课件第八章 1-2年生花卉.ppt
- 《花卉生产技术知识》课件第十一章 水生花卉.ppt
- 《花卉生产技术知识》课件第十九章 落叶灌木花卉牡丹、月季.ppt
- 《花卉生产技术知识》课件第十章 球根花卉.ppt
- 《药品经营质量相关管理规范现场检查指导原则》-零售企业.ppt
- 《薪酬相关管理》第一章:薪酬与薪酬相关管理.ppt
- 《薪酬相关管理》第七章:薪酬设计.ppt
- 参考学习资料 生物学习 万多黏盲鳗.pdf
- 参考学习资料 生物学习 新疆迟滞鳄类新材料.pdf
- 参考学习资料 生物学习 尤嘉鲂甲鱼新标本.pdf
- 参考学习资料 生物学习 犹他州南部上三叠世岩石地层学、沉积体系和古脊椎动物.pdf
- 参考学习资料 生物学习 亚利桑那州钦勒群上三叠统猫头鹰岩层的四足动物群.pdf
- 参考学习资料 生物学习 斜横螈科组织学骨组织研究的初步成果.pdf
- 参考学习资料 生物学习 新南威尔士的一种奥陶纪脊椎动物.pdf
- 参考学习资料 生物学习 异甲鱼亚纲内部系统发育关系.pdf
- 参考学习资料 生物学习 伊朗中部Negheleh剖面中泥盆世牙形石生物地层的修订.pdf
- 参考学习资料 生物学习 用超基质法研究盲鳗科的分子系统发育和分类.pdf
最近下载
- 美国fda生产过程(工艺)验证总则指南中英文版.doc VIP
- 成都理工大学2020-2021学年第2学期《环境监测》期末考试试卷及标准答案.docx
- 2024年江苏省无锡市中考英语真题卷(含答案与解析).docx VIP
- 年产水性油墨、凹版塑料环保油墨4500 吨、水性涂料500吨建设项目环评(2021年新版环评)环境影响报告表.pdf VIP
- fda美国食品药物管理局工艺验证指南英文版).doc VIP
- 金属非金属露天矿山建设项目安全设施竣工验收表.pdf VIP
- 单位员工网络安全培训.pptx VIP
- PQE试用期述职报告.pptx VIP
- 《GBT 30130-2023胶版印刷纸》最新解读.pptx
- GJB9001C:2017研发一整套资料模板(共348页).pdf VIP
文档评论(0)